EQUS UQ Q&A 2018

Monthly showcase of quantum physics research

The EQUS Q&A series at the University of Queensland showcases current research in quantum physics taking place in our Centre. 

The sessions are usually held during lunchtime. Each month will be organised by a different research group.

Seminars will start at 12.00pm and run to 1.30pm. 

Food will be provided. 

2018 sessions:

  • Friday, February 23 - Peter Wittek from the University of Toronto on "Quantum-Enhanced Machine Learning in Practice"
  • Tuesday, April 3 - Theo Rasing from Radboud University, Institute for Molecules and Materials on "Jumping Crystals" (RSVP required)
  • Monday, May 21 - Niccolo Somaschi of Quandela on "Accelerating optical quantum technologies with quantum-dot based devices"
  • Tuesday, July 10 - Andres Rosario Hamann on "Nonreciprocal device with two superconducting qubits in a waveguide"
